A 22-year-old labourer from Assam, identified as Prabash Doley, was allegedly murdered in Itanagar, Arunachal Pradesh, after a dispute over construction noise. This grim incident has sparked an intense investigation led by local police.
The victim's body was discovered near an under-construction building in Chimpu's Saturday Market area, raising alarms within the community. Tai John, 26, a local car wash operator, has been apprehended as the prime suspect in the case.
According to Superintendent of Police Rohit Rajbir Singh, multiple eyewitnesses have stepped forward, assisting in piecing together the events leading to the murder. Forensic evidence, including the suspected murder weapon, is being examined to ensure a thorough investigation.
